The industrial relevance of pyridine continues to expand as technological advancements unlock new application areas. From agrochemicals to pharmaceuticals, its role as a versatile intermediate ensures ongoing demand. This compound’s stability and compatibility with various chemical reactions make it indispensable for multiple production processes.

Agricultural productivity remains a primary growth driver. Pyridine-based compounds contribute to effective pest control and crop enhancement strategies, supporting food security objectives worldwide. Meanwhile, pharmaceutical applications include the production of anti-inflammatory drugs, vitamins, and other medicinal compounds.
